WebJun 30, 2024 · d = v 0 t cos θ H = h + v 0 t sin θ − 1 2 g t 2. This is a two-by-two nonlinear system of equations for ( v 0, θ) . We solve this system with a standard method. The system is equivalent to. (1) v 0 t cos θ = d (2) v 0 t sin θ = H − h + 1 2 g t 2. We square each side of (1) and (2), add, and use Pythagoras' theorem with the result. WebProjectile motion is a form of motion experienced by an object or particle (a projectile) that is projected in a gravitational field, such as from Earth's surface, and moves along a curved path under the action of gravity only. In the particular case of projectile motion of Earth, most calculations assume the effects of air resistance are passive and negligible.
